Copper Brown Hair

Copper brown hair is a rich, warm shade that looks great on nearly every skin tone. If you’re looking to go blonde and are nervous about your hair breaking off, reddish brown tones will work wonders for your locks. The cool part about copper brown hair is that it works well with any skin tone—it’s a great option for brunettes looking to change up their look without having to go all-out blonde, or natural blondes who want a richer color without going too far into the red spectrum.
